What Themes Work Best for Different Age Groups?
Choosing the right theme for your child's wall art depends heavily on their age and developmental stage. What fascinates a toddler will likely bore a pre-teen, so tailoring your selections is key to creating a space they truly love and benefit from. For infants and toddlers, think bright colours, simple shapes, and familiar animals. Prints featuring friendly bears, playful kittens, or colourful balloons are always a hit. These images stimulate visual development and create a cheerful atmosphere. As children enter preschool, their interests broaden. They might become fascinated by dinosaurs, outer space, or fairy tales. Wall art depicting these themes can spark their imagination and encourage storytelling.
School-aged children often have more defined preferences. They might be passionate about sports, music, or specific cartoon characters. Involving them in the selection process ensures that the wall art reflects their personality and interests. Consider canvas prints that showcase their favourite hobbies or feature inspirational quotes from athletes or artists they admire. For teenagers, the focus shifts towards expressing their individuality and creating a space that feels sophisticated and personal. Abstract art, photographic prints, or minimalist designs are often popular choices. You can also explore options that reflect their academic interests, such as maps for geography lovers or scientific diagrams for budding scientists. Remember to choose high-quality materials that will last for years to come. How Can Wall Art Be Used to Enhance Learning?
Wall art isn't just about aesthetics; it can also be a powerful tool for enhancing learning and development in a child's room. By strategically choosing educational prints, you can create a stimulating environment that encourages curiosity and reinforces key concepts. Consider incorporating alphabet charts, number grids, or maps of the world. These visual aids can help children learn basic skills and expand their knowledge of the world around them. For younger children, colourful illustrations of animals, plants, or objects can help them build vocabulary and develop their understanding of different concepts. As they get older, you can introduce more complex subjects, such as the solar system, the human body, or historical figures.
Wall art can also be used to promote positive values and character traits. Prints featuring inspirational quotes, acts of kindness, or diverse cultures can help children develop empathy, compassion, and a sense of social responsibility. You can even create a "growth mindset" gallery wall with prints that emphasize the importance of perseverance, effort, and learning from mistakes. To make learning even more engaging, consider incorporating interactive elements into your wall art. For example, you could create a magnetic board with letters and numbers that children can use to practice spelling and math. Or you could hang a world map with pins that they can use to mark places they've visited or want to visit. What Are Some Creative Ways to Display Wall Art in a Kid's Room?
Beyond simply hanging a canvas on the wall, there are numerous creative ways to display wall art in a kid's room, adding personality and visual interest to the space. One popular option is to create a gallery wall. This involves grouping multiple prints of varying sizes and styles together to create a cohesive and eye-catching display. You can mix and match different types of art, such as canvas prints, framed posters, and even your child's own artwork. To create a balanced look, consider using a consistent colour palette or theme throughout the gallery wall. Another fun idea is to use wall decals or removable wallpaper to create a mural or accent wall. This is a great way to add a playful touch to the room without making a permanent commitment. You can find decals in a variety of designs, from whimsical landscapes to geometric patterns. For a more unique and personalized display, consider using floating shelves to showcase your child's favourite books, toys, and artwork. This is a great way to create a dynamic and ever-changing display that reflects their interests and personality.
You can also get creative with framing. Instead of using traditional frames, consider using colourful washi tape or clothespins to hang prints on the wall. This is a fun and inexpensive way to add a touch of whimsy to the room. Another option is to create a DIY frame using recycled materials, such as cardboard or wood scraps. When displaying wall art in a kid's room, it's important to consider safety. Make sure that all frames and hanging hardware are securely attached to the wall and out of reach of young children. You can also use safety glass or acrylic instead of regular glass to prevent breakage. How Do You Choose the Right Colours and Styles for a Kid's Room?
Selecting the right colours and styles for a kid's room can significantly impact the overall feel and atmosphere of the space. While personal preference plays a large role, there are some general guidelines to keep in mind. Start by considering the age and personality of your child. Younger children often respond well to bright, cheerful colours and playful designs, while older children may prefer more sophisticated and calming palettes. When it comes to colour, consider the psychological effects of different hues. Blue is often associated with calmness and serenity, while yellow is known for its cheerful and energizing qualities. Green is a natural and refreshing colour, while red can be stimulating and exciting. Use these associations to create a colour scheme that aligns with your child's personality and the overall mood you want to create in the room.
In terms of style, consider the overall aesthetic of your home. Do you prefer a modern, minimalist look or a more traditional and cozy feel? Choose wall art that complements the existing décor and creates a cohesive look. You can also incorporate your child's interests and hobbies into the design. For example, if your child loves animals, you could choose prints featuring their favourite creatures. If they're passionate about sports, you could create a gallery wall showcasing their favourite athletes or teams. When selecting wall art, consider the size and scale of the room. Large, bold prints can make a statement in a larger room, while smaller, more delicate prints may be better suited for a smaller space. What About Wall Art for Shared Kids' Rooms?
Designing a shared kids' room presents unique challenges, especially when it comes to wall art. The key is to find a balance between individual expression and creating a cohesive space that both children can enjoy. Start by considering the ages, genders, and interests of each child. If they have vastly different preferences, you may need to find a compromise or create distinct zones within the room. One approach is to divide the room visually using paint colours or furniture placement. Each child can then decorate their designated area with wall art that reflects their personality and interests. If you prefer a more unified look, consider choosing a common theme or colour palette that appeals to both children. For example, you could create a nature-themed room with prints featuring trees, animals, and landscapes. Or you could opt for a more abstract or geometric style that is less specific to individual interests.
Another option is to create a gallery wall that incorporates a mix of prints that reflect both children's interests. You can include individual portraits, shared hobbies, and inspirational quotes that resonate with both of them. When choosing wall art for a shared room, it's important to consider the size and scale of the space. Avoid overcrowding the walls with too many prints, as this can make the room feel cluttered and overwhelming.
